This podcast follows science by diving into recent discoveries, interviewing various professionals in the field, and exploring different topics in a fun, yet informative manner.

Genetic Keys: Unlocking the APOE4 Connection in Alzheimer's Disease 12.07.2024

In this episode of "Following Science," we delve into the genetic underpinnings of Alzheimer's disease, focusing on a groundbreaking study led by Drs. Juan Fortea and Victor Montal. Published in Nature Medicine, this research reveals the significant impact of the APOE4 gene variant on Alzheimer's progression, particularly among APOE4 homozygotes. Heroin's Hidden Key to Parkinson’s 21.06.2024

Join us on "Following Science" as we uncover the incredible story of how a synthetic heroin derivative led to a groundbreaking discovery in Parkinson's disease research. Dive into the early 1980s, when a mysterious drug caused severe Parkinson' s-like symptoms in users, sparking a scientific investigation that would change our understanding of the disease.
